Abstract

Cervical cancer is considered a major public health problem and a major cause of tumor-related deaths in women. Virtually all cases of cervical cancer, as well as an increasing proportion of tumors in the anal and head / neck areas, are associated with infection by human papillomavirus (HPV), of which the genotypes HPV-16 and 18 are the most commonly related to these tumors. In this project we will explore a therapeutic vaccine strategy against these tumors using a recombinant form of HPV-16 E7 oncoprotein fused to the glycoprotein D (gD) of HSV-1, a protein with properties of endogenous adjuvants, particularly for CD8 + T lymphocytes. The recombinant protein will be produced in Escherichia coli and insect cells infected with baculovirus for further purification. The recombinant protein will be tested as subunit vaccines for parenteral administration in combination with different adjuvants and immunomodulatory agents. The therapeutic properties of the vaccine formulations will be evaluated in mice challenged with TC-1 cells which express the E6 and E7 oncoproteins of HPV-16. The E7-specific immune responses mediated primarily by CD8 + T lymphocytes will also be measured. The results obtained during the execution of this project should contribute to the development of a novel vaccine strategy for the control of tumors induced by HPV-16. (AU)
